I'm no expert, but that looks like a dana 60 to me. The studs and only one U-bolt on the passenger side is what makes me believe it is. Someone better snatch this one up!
 
Cant really tell from the pics other than the perch studs. But if it came out of a newer Dodge 3/4 ton, then it is a balljoint D60...

But one thing has me puzzled. They were disconnect axles since thee were no lockouts. BUt this axle doesn't have the disconnect housing.

Did the pre-94 Dodges have no hubs and no disconnect,, and a balljoint 60????
 
It's a D44. I don't know why, but Dodge made some of their trucks with 44's having 2 studs on the passenger side leaf pad like a D60. That's why it doesnt have the center disco.
 
Dodge D44. Dodge uses studs in the pumpkins side on D44 and D60 just the same. It looks like a full time unit so not worth a whole lot since you will need x-over to shove it in a GM.
